The Charms of the Genil Riverbank Route

A circular route on foot or by bike that combines nature, a Renaissance bridge, a castle, waterwheels and the La Grieta viewpoint.
A circular route of great natural and heritage value that allows you to discover some of Benamejí’s major scenic and historical landmarks. It passes by the La Grieta viewpoint, the watermill on the River Genil, the Renaissance bridge by Hernán Ruiz II, and sites of Arab origin such as the Gómez Arias castle and part of the river’s system of waterwheels. The route is suitable for both walking and cycling and offers a comprehensive overview of the connection between the town centre, the banks of the Genil and the local historical heritage.
